Midwest Queer & Trans Zine Fest
TypeZine fest, Conference
FrequencyAnnual
Years held2023–2024
OrganizersLate Night Copies
Scheduling
Usual datesMid-October
ApplicationsEarly June
The above are based on the last fair/conference held in 2024.
Location
VenueOpen Books
Location

1011 Washington Ave S
Minneapolis, MN 55415

CountryUnited States
Contact
Websitemqtzf.com
Instagram@midwestqtzinefest
Email[email protected]

The Midwest Queer & Trans Zinefest is a two-day fair for QT vendors in the midwest. It started in 2023, and in 2024 incorporated a one-day conference hosted at the Tretter Collection in GLBT Studies. Future events are planned to rotate through different midwest states and regional partners.

We will not accept applications from any cishet zinesters. Allies: we welcome you to attend the zine fest and buy work from queer and trans artists.
